The kingdom of Sindh was ruled by its last king Raja Dahir during the 8th century when Muhammad-bin-Qasim invaded Sindh, he decimated Sindh in his savage blood lust. The chroniclas of his advent are described in the Chachnama.

The Chaschnama described in details hwo the Arabs led by butcher Qasim conquered Sindh. It tells the terrible tales of bravery, treachery, & carnage marking the entry of Islamic conquest of India’s Hindus.

When Mohammad-bin-Qasim attacked Sindh, Dahir had collected an army of 50,000 horses and marched from Brahamanabad to Rewar to face the invader. Qasim had an army that numbered in the tens of thousands of camels and horses.

Earlier Arab Alafis- Syeds form Prophet Mohammed’s own family had fled from Macca with 500 men to Singh and Raja Dahir had given them asylum. Trusting these Muslims would prove to be the most fatal mistake of the downfall of Sindh and pave the way for Islamic invasion.

ON an “auspicious day” in A.D. 711, fixed to astrologers, Mohammad-bin-Qasim started for Sindh at the head of Iraqi and Syrian, and other Arabic soldiers. His horses and camles were disguised to look like lions and elephants. Rebel Jats also joined Qasim’s army.

In the way Arabs besieged Dabal  (“Devalay”-a temple) the ragged for 10 days even though it was not a major town. The temple fell when a frightened boy told the Arabs to rbing down the huge Bhagwa flag to demoralize the town. The carnage & Bloodshed followed.

Then Arabs went next to Nerunkot ( Hydrabad, Pakistan) Just when the Arabs were running out of food and fodder, Bhandakaran Shramani, the Buddhist incharge of Nerunkot, surrendered the town. The Buddhist said -they were men of peace and not interested in who ruled the country.

The same happened in the next town Sehwan where Buddhists did not allow Bachehra, the governor to defend the town after a week. At the time when the Arabs didn’t know how to cross the Sindhu, Mokah, a Buddhist, gave boats & provisions in return for money & land.

On 16th June 712 CE, the final and fierce battel was fought between Qasim & Dahir, Sadly a lieutenant of the treacherous Alafi whom Dahir had given asylum, secretly betrayed Dahir’s plan. Dahir was beheaded & his army had to flee from the battlefield.

Part of Dahir’s army fled back to Aror, the capital, and others, with Dahir’s son Jayasimha, to Brahamanabad. Dahir’s Brave widow Queen Rani bai, a trained warrior- had to flee the fort of Rawar with all the women & 1500 remaining troopes.

Right away Qasim chased after her & besieged the fort of Rawar. His soldiers began to dig & destroy the fortifications. Queen Rani bai, courageously put up a fierce resistance, and fought bravely to defend the fort for the four days.

Finally when the army was exhausted and she had been fatally injured, she along with other lady warriors of her court, bravely committed Jauhar in the fire to escape the horrors of falling into hands of “Chandals and cow eaters”
